SRP Big Block Chevy GM 572 Replacement Series Pistons

  • Direct replacement for OEM GM 572 piston in Flat Top or Dome configuration
  • 4032 low expansion high silicon aluminum alloy heat treated to SRP specifications
  • CNC Machined domes with radiused valve reliefs provide optimum flame travel
  • Pin fitting and double spiro locks (990-042-CS) included
  • 990-2930-150-51S wrist pins (150 grams) included
  • CNC Machined ring grooves accept 1/16, 1/16, 3/16 rings (Rings Sold Separately)
  • Optional bearing steel pins available
Ring package designed for: 1/16, 1/16, 3/16 Rings

Mercedes B55 (2011) - a ballistic V8 B-class

Fri, 31 Dec 2010

Mercedes' tuning arm AMG has not yet ventured into sensible B-class territory, but a bunch of Merc trainees in Germany has come up with this: the B55. It's a V8-powered B-class, complete with AMG-spec 383bhp 5.5-litre V8 mounted up front and driving an old W210 E-class rear axle. Sounds like a promising skunkworks special, derived from an old B200 CDI hack that was kicking about the training centre.

Victor Muller sells Spyker sports cars to CPP

Thu, 24 Feb 2011

Supercar maker Spyker is to be sold. Coventry-based coachbuilder CPP has announced a memorandum of understanding (MOU) to buy Spyker Cars from Spyker Cars N.V, the holding company which owns Spyker and Saab. No. Saab remains under the ownership of Dutch company Spyker Cars N.V. This sale is of Spyker, the manufacturer of flamboyantly detailed mid-engined supercars. CPP has been supplying chassis and body panels for Spyker since the brand was relaunched in 2000, and completed an agreement to handle full manufacturing of the current range in 2009 – the production of Spyker cars moved from the Netherlands to Coventry in 2010.   The MOU, valued at €32m, will mean that CPP Global Holdings Ltd will become manufacturer and owner of Spyker – €15m will be paid straight away, with the remaining €17m paid over a six year 'earn-out' period.

Mazda 2 (2015) first to get new 1.5 Skyactiv diesel

Wed, 11 Jun 2014

By Michael Karkafiris Motor Industry 11 June 2014 15:32 Mazda’s new 2 will be the first model to premiere the company’s latest downsized Skyactiv diesel engine, it has confirmed. The Japanese car maker today revealed the technical specifications of its new 1.5-litre oil-burner, which promises to be highly efficient and low-polluting. The new member of the eco-friendly Skyactiv engine family produces 103bhp at 4000rpm and 184lb ft of torque between 1500-2500rpm, says Mazda.
